About

Linn Jaw [Waterfall] is a named viewpoint in central Scotland, marked on Ordnance Survey maps for its outlook. It sits within the Livingston parliamentary constituency. The nearest railway station is Livingston South, about 2.3 km away. Postcode area EH54.
